曼大学生统计资料
Students and staffStudent numbers- Undergraduate - 26,460
- Postgraduate - 9,195
- Graduate employers - 13,500 companies
- Alumni - 180,000 in 192 countries
- Continuing education attendees - 60,000 per annum
The University of Manchester receives 63,000 undergraduate applications per annum. This makes us the most popular university in the country.

MulticulturalThe University, like Manchester itself, is a multicultural environment and home to around 7,400 international students from 180 countries (see table, right).
6 i6 q- G }0 {& ~: OSchools- More than 80,000 school students every year benefit from the University's outreach, inclusion and school and college liaison activities
- Seven summer schools are organised every year for more than 600 students
- More than 1000 local school children have used our Library Access facility
- 26,000 school children visited The Manchester Museum last year
- More than 100 professional healthcare and science mentors provide one-to-one guidance for local school pupils
StaffThere are 11,330 staff employed by the University of Manchester, making us one of the biggest employers in the north-west. This includes more than 5,000 academic and research staff.8 H* F% r9 \2 Q+ q! G0 i! B3 J
Breakdown of staff- Academic - 3,502
- Research - 1,718
- Management/professional - 1,284
- Clerical - 1,841
- Manual - 966
- Technical - 850
- Computing/IT - 294
- Library assistants - 202
- Craft - 106
- Nursing/professions allied to nursing - 77
- Other - 490
- Total - 11,330
